FSC Vice Chair Discusses Virtual Asset Regulation Trends with US SEC

Kim So-young, Vice Chairperson of the Financial Services Commission (FSC), met with Mark Uyeda, Commissioner of the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), to discuss virtual asset regulation trends in Korea and the US. Commissioner Uyeda expressed interest in Korea's efforts to balance technological innovation and user protection in virtual asset regulation. Vice Chairperson Kim outlined Korea's inter-ministerial cooperation in promoting blockchain innovation while prioritizing user protection and market stability through the Virtual Asset Utilization Protection Act. Both sides emphasized the importance of communication and cooperation in shaping the new financial market order based on blockchain and AI innovations.
